|
static | getAllEnriched ($sortby='position', $order='ASC', $row_count=null, $offset=null) |
|
static | getAllSorted () |
|
static | findByStudiengang ($studiengang_id) |
|
static | getClassDisplayName ($long=false) |
|
static | findBySearchTerm ($search_term, $filter=null) |
|
static | getAll () |
|
static | get ($id=null) |
|
static | getEnriched ($id) |
|
static | getEnrichedByQuery ($query=null, $params=[], $row_count=null, $offset=null) |
|
static | getClassDisplayName ($long=false) |
|
static | getFilterSql ($filter, $where=false, $or_sql=null) |
|
static | getContentArray (SimpleORMap $sorm, $to_utf8=true) |
|
static | getCount ($filter=null) |
|
static | getCountBySql ($sql, $filter=null) |
|
static | setLanguage ($language) |
|
static | setContentLanguage ($language) |
|
static | getLanguage () = htmlReady($modul['name']) |
|
static | getLocaleOrdinalNumberSuffix ($num) |
|
static | getPublicStatus ($class_name=null) |
|
static | findCached ($id, $index=null) |
|
static | clearCache ($index=null) |
|
static | tableScheme ($db_table) |
|
static | expireTableScheme () |
|
static | exists ($id) |
|
static | countBySql ($sql='1', $params=[]) |
|
static | create ($data) |
|
static | build ($data, $is_new=true) |
|
static | buildExisting ($data) |
|
static | import ($data) |
|
static | findBySQL ($sql, $params=[]) |
|
static | findOneBySQL ($where, $params=[]) |
|
static | findThru ($foreign_key_value, $options) |
|
static | findEachBySQL ($callable, $sql, $params=[]) |
|
static | findMany ($pks=[], $order='', $order_params=[]) |
|
static | findEachMany ($callable, $pks=[], $order='', $order_params=[]) |
|
static | findAndMapBySQL ($callable, $where, $params=[]) |
|
static | findAndMapMany ($callable, $pks=[], $order='', $order_params=[]) |
|
static | deleteBySQL ($where, $params=[]) |
|
static | toObject ($id_or_object) |
|
static | __callStatic (string $name, array $arguments) |
|
|
| $object_real_name = '' |
|
const | ID_SEPARATOR = '_' |
|
static | $schemes = null |
|
| logChanges ($action=null) |
|
| _getId ($field) |
|
| _setId ($field, $value) |
|
| _getAdditionalValueFromRelation ($field) |
|
| _setAdditionalValueFromRelation ($field, $value) |
|
| _getAdditionalValue ($field) |
|
| _setAdditionalValue ($field, $value) |
|
| parseRelationOptions ($type, $name, $options) |
|
| storeRelations ($only_these=null) |
|
| deleteRelations () |
|
| initializeContent () |
|
| applyCallbacks ($type) |
|
| cbNotificationMapper ($cb_type) |
|
| cbAfterInitialize ($cb_type) |
|
| setSerializedValue ($field, $value) |
|
| setI18nValue ($field, $value) |
|
| $is_dirty = false |
|
| $content = [] |
|
| $content_db = [] |
|
| $is_new = true |
|
| $is_deleted = false |
|
| $relations = [] |
|
| $additional_data = [] |
|
string | $i18n_class = I18NString::class |
|
static | $filter_params = [] |
|
static | $perm_object = null |
|
static | $object_cache = [] |
|
static | $config = [] |
|
static | $reserved_slots = ['value','newid','iterator','tablemetadata', 'relationvalue','wherequery','relationoptions','data','new','id'] |
|
static | $performs_batch_operation = false |
|